Ruby Colley

Belfast-based violinist & composer. A classically trained violinist, Ruby's solo material also comprises the use of a variety of peddles, such as a loop-station, delay, and octave, in order to create complex overlapping layers of ambient sound-scapes. http://www.myspace.com/rubycolley Her first EP My Elegant Insect was released in early May 2008, and she has played support to the likes of Final Fantasy (Owen Pallett), A Hawk and a Hacksaw (LEAF label), and the late John Martyn; her debut album "Murmurations" is due for release in 2010.

Rainbow Down

Rainbow Down is an electro/homo/solo artist based in Nottingham. After spending many years as the vocalist and lyricist of several different bands (including melodic hardcore band Escaping Skies) that all crumbled due to frustrating external factors, Rainbow Down took it upon himself to start writing his own songs. After being shown and learning some basic programming from various friends and musicians, he used a combination of Reason, Audacity and an mp3 player's microphone to start producing his music at the tail end end of summer 2008.

The Monster Goes RAWRR

The Monster Goes Rawrr!! is a rock/electro band that formed in mid-2009 in Brisbane, Australia. The band consists of Maxwell Wiens (lead vocals), Adam Kremer (lead guitar/backing vocals), Benson Willemse (bass guitar), Brendan Dunstan (rhythm guitar/backing vocals), Alexandria Savva (keyboards/backing vocals) and David Soole (electric drums).

Cat Power

Charlyn Marie Marshall, also known as Chan (pronounced "Shawn") Marshall, was born in Atlanta, Georgia, U.S. on 21 January 1972. After dropping out of high school, she started performing under the name Cat Power, while in Atlanta, backed by musicians Glen Thrasher, Mark Moore, and others. She soon moved to New York City, United States in 1992, then later opening for Liz Phair in 1994, she met Steve Shelley of Sonic Youth and Tim Foljahn of Two Dollar Guitar, who encouraged her to record, and played on her first two albums, 1995's Dear Sir and 1996's Myra Lee.

Esperi

Esperi is the project of Chris Lee-marr, who plays both solo and with the help of his friends Cat Lee-Marr (harp), Jon Adam (drums), Craig Arnott (bass) and Eilidh Glynn (cello). Chris also plays in The A Forest with Cat and Eilidh.
